Boebert's Ex-Husband Regrets 'Overreaction' After Restaurant Altercation
-
Jayson Boebert, Rep. Lauren Boebert's ex-husband, says he "overreacted" when he called police after an altercation with her at a restaurant. He wishes it hadn't happened.
-
The conflict began when Jayson tried to hug Lauren when she was picking up their kid. An aide said Jayson later became "lewd" and "aggressive."
-
Lauren's aide denies punching claims, but Jayson initially told police he was "a victim of domestic violence." No one was arrested.
-
Jayson has since apologized, said he "overreacted," and asked for charges against Lauren to be dropped. Lauren is considering legal options against false claims.
-
Both Lauren and Jayson wish the incident hadn't happened and regret how they handled it. Jayson admires Lauren and says she's "a great person."
